Optimisation of data locality in energy calculations for large-scale molecular dynamics simulations

被引:2
|
作者
Luo, Jinping [1 ]
Liu, Lijun [1 ]
机构
[1] Xi An Jiao Tong Univ, Sch Energy & Power Engn, Key Lab Thermofluid Sci & Engn, Minist Educ, Xian, Peoples R China
基金
中国国家自然科学基金;
关键词
Molecular dynamics; data locality; reordering; parallel; NEIGHBOR LIST ALGORITHM; VERLET LISTS; GENERATION; COMPUTER; DESIGN;
D O I
10.1080/08927022.2016.1267354
中图分类号
O64 [物理化学(理论化学)、化学物理学];
学科分类号
070304 ; 081704 ;
摘要
The main bottleneck of molecular dynamic simulations is the estimation of nonbonded pairwise interaction, which often employs neighbour search algorithms to find out interacting atom pairs. These methods have some drawbacks in fulfilling data locality principle, which is unable to take full advantage of modern computer architecture. In this article, we developed a new method by introducing a temporary list to reduce the sparsity in data access. This list permits to obtain a compact and sequential data structure which benefits to efficiently fulfil the data locality principle. We tested and compared the performance of the new method with that of the extensively used reordering method. The new method based on linked cell list is shown to increase 13% of computation speed and have better parallelism in comparison with reordering method. The increase in parallel efficiency makes the new method a promising option for large-scale molecular simulations.
引用
收藏
页码:284 / 290
页数:7
相关论文
共 50 条
  • [1] Controlling the data glut in large-scale molecular-dynamics simulations
    Beazley, DM
    Lomdahl, PS
    [J]. COMPUTERS IN PHYSICS, 1997, 11 (03): : 230 - 238
  • [2] Impact of multicores on large-scale molecular dynamics simulations
    Alam, Sadaf R.
    Agarwal, Pratul K.
    Hampton, Scott S.
    Ong, Hong
    Vetter, Jeffrey S.
    [J]. 2008 IEEE INTERNATIONAL SYMPOSIUM ON PARALLEL & DISTRIBUTED PROCESSING, VOLS 1-8, 2008, : 544 - 550
  • [3] Parallel computation of large-scale molecular dynamics simulations
    Kwon, Sungjin
    Lee, Youngmin
    Im, Seyoung
    [J]. Experimental Mechanics in Nano and Biotechnology, Pts 1 and 2, 2006, 326-328 : 341 - 344
  • [4] Large-scale molecular simulations of dynamics in mechanical proteins
    Dima, Ruxandra I.
    [J]. ABSTRACTS OF PAPERS OF THE AMERICAN CHEMICAL SOCIETY, 2011, 242
  • [5] Asymptotic extrapolation scheme for large-scale calculations with hybrid coupled cluster and molecular dynamics simulations
    Kowalski, Karol
    Valiev, Marat
    [J]. JOURNAL OF PHYSICAL CHEMISTRY A, 2006, 110 (48): : 13106 - 13111
  • [6] Large-scale molecular dynamics simulations of high energy cluster impact on diamond surface
    Y. Yamaguchi
    J. Gspann
    [J]. The European Physical Journal D - Atomic, Molecular, Optical and Plasma Physics, 2001, 16 : 103 - 106
  • [7] Large-scale molecular dynamics simulations of high energy cluster impact on diamond surface
    Yamaguchi, Y
    Gspann, J
    [J]. EUROPEAN PHYSICAL JOURNAL D, 2001, 16 (1-3): : 103 - 106
  • [8] A scalable parallel framework for microstructure analysis of large-scale molecular dynamics simulations data
    Wu, Guoqing
    Song, Haifeng
    Lin, Deye
    [J]. COMPUTATIONAL MATERIALS SCIENCE, 2018, 144 : 322 - 330
  • [9] Large-scale molecular dynamics simulations of glancing angle deposition
    Hubartt, Bradley C.
    Liu, Xuejing
    Amar, Jacques G.
    [J]. JOURNAL OF APPLIED PHYSICS, 2013, 114 (08)
  • [10] Large-scale molecular dynamics simulations of materials on parallel computers
    Nakano, A
    Campbell, TJ
    Kalia, RK
    Kodiyalam, S
    Ogata, S
    Shimojo, F
    Vashishta, P
    Walsh, P
    [J]. ADVANCED COMPUTING AND ANALYSIS TECHNIQUES IN PHYSICS RESEARCH, 2001, 583 : 57 - 62